Abstract
Fuzzy Causal Rule Bases (FCRb) are widely used and are the most important rule bases in Rule Based Fuzzy Cognitive Maps (RB-FCM). However, FCRb are subject to several restrictions that create difficulties in their creation and completion. This paper proposes a method to optimally complete FCRb using Fuzzy Boolean Net properties as qualitative universal approximators. Although the proposed approach focuses on FCRb, it can be generalized to any fuzzy rule base.
